What they do

An Accounts Payable or Receivable Clerk keeps records of accounts and financial transactions, with specific responsibility for Accounts Payable/Receivable. Works for a business or bookkeeping service. Provides information for financial and tax reports completed by an accountant.

Job Description

We are looking for an Accounts Receivable Clerk to support day-to-day cash application and collections activities. This long-term contract position is ideal for someone who is organized and comfortable managing customer payments, account reconciliation, and billing-related follow-up. The role requires strong communication skills and the ability to work across teams to resolve payment questions and maintain accurate receivable records.
Responsibilities:
  • Record and post customer remittances received through checks, electronic payments, and wire transfers to the appropriate accounts.
  • Match incoming funds to open invoices and ensure payment activity is reflected accurately in receivable records.
  • Review outstanding balances on a routine basis and contact customers regarding overdue invoices to support timely collection.
  • Investigate payment discrepancies, including short remittances, chargebacks, and unapplied cash, and take corrective action to resolve them.
  • Respond to customer questions related to invoices, payment status, and account balances in a clear and courteous manner.
  • Prepare and distribute credit documentation and account statements when needed to support account maintenance.
  • Partner with sales and customer support teams to address billing concerns and help resolve account issues efficiently.
  • Contribute to audit preparation and provide accounts receivable reporting or other assigned support to management.
